Section 49-4-35 - Marked and unmarked department vehicles; violations and penalties

(1) The Department of Wildlife, Fisheries and Parks shall distinctively mark all vehicles used by conservation officers to enforce game and fish laws. Vehicles used for law enforcement purposes shall have the words 'Law Enforcement' printed in bold letters in a color which is in contrast with the color of the vehicle, under the official insignia of the department.(2) The department may authorize the use of unmarked vehicles when identifying marks would hinder official investigations by the department.(3) Any person who knowingly and wilfully violates this section is guilty of a misdemeanor and is punishable as provided in Section 25-1-91, Mississippi Code of 1972.Laws, 1992, ch. 526, § 1, eff. 7/1/1992.
